Output 3aa623e8faedd035ba2e914fb0cbe9366743cce3e577eefd1152f348ab8973f3:0

value
25598387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fd2b585a818444c58fdb0bbfad06d4cbbf550ff OP_EQUAL
address
37WUuxAfDCbxS7QbE5gSRZtKKCZaVgoPyR
transaction
3aa623e8faedd035ba2e914fb0cbe9366743cce3e577eefd1152f348ab8973f3
confirmations
2008
spent
true